Preparing for single fatherhood after divorce

Getting ready to be a single father after divorce can be a challenging and life-changing experience. Adjusting to your new role while dealing with the emotional aftermath of divorce can feel overwhelming. However, with the right mindset and support, you can successfully navigate this transition and create a fulfilling life for you and your children.

It is important to review some practical tips to help you on your journey as a single father.

Self-care and dealing with your ex

After ending your marriage, prioritize self-care and emotional well-being. Divorce can take a toll on your mental health, so be sure to seek support from friends and family to process your feelings and emotions. Taking care of yourself will enable you to be a better parent and role model for your children. Remember that many other fathers find themselves in this position. In fact, the Census Bureau says there were two million single fathers during 2016.

Effective communication and cooperation with your ex-partner can help create a stable and supportive environment for your kids. Remember to focus on the best interests of your children and put aside any personal differences for their sake.

Structure and planning

Creating a routine and structure for your children can provide a sense of stability and security during this period of transition. Set up a schedule for meals, bedtime, schoolwork and other activities to help your children adjust to their new living situation. Consistency and predictability can help alleviate any anxieties or uncertainties they may have. Financial planning is another important aspect to consider as a single father. Review your budget, expenses and long-term financial goals to ensure that you can provide for your children’s needs.

Becoming a single father after divorce is a significant life change that comes with its own set of challenges and rewards. With the right approach, you can successfully navigate single fatherhood and create a loving and nurturing environment for your children.
